Output fc81cc4a34822d7f37dc4898675a19f7ff0c558bca7084d432c1dc9490341cfe:3

value
1224939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d1fa147d995041939b69d1a06d162c62e54aa57 OP_EQUAL
address
3EZD6HN6qkuGo5qW8mQ2LaSHhp671HP3ko
transaction
fc81cc4a34822d7f37dc4898675a19f7ff0c558bca7084d432c1dc9490341cfe
spent
true